CFAs: L-Grant “Local Insights Impact Award” in Malaysia

#image_title

Deadline: 31-Mar-2026

The L-Grant “Local Insights Impact Award” is inviting applications to support young researchers working on innovative projects that transform local knowledge and resources into global impact. Selected applicants will receive a research grant of 7,000 MYR to advance research aligned with the programme’s thematic focus areas in Malaysia.

Overview

The L-Grant “Local Insights Impact Award” is designed to support the research activities of young researchers while also helping them build connections with industry.

The award encourages research that turns localized insights, traditional knowledge, biodiversity, and local resources into innovative, scalable, and globally relevant solutions.

FAQs

What is the grant amount?

Selected applicants will receive 7,000 MYR.

Who is eligible to apply?

Researchers who are based in Malaysia or conducting research in Malaysia can apply, provided their work fits the thematic focus.

What kind of research is supported?

The grant supports research that transforms localized knowledge, biodiversity, traditional medicine, and local resources into innovative solutions with broader impact.

Does the programme support industry connection?

Yes. In addition to supporting research activity, the award also aims to help young researchers connect with the industry side.

What is the main goal of the award?

Its goal is to encourage original and impactful research that can convert local insights into globally relevant innovations.
